Output 6877fa630e6da41ab598025f5b0dba4380e40b6845626eb10a2e085d8c5a8488:62

value
641721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9754704bbb9f2559c913fd7431cb2ff75032f60 OP_EQUAL
address
3MWq3kNnLq4jYLcTFmy2SwXYzzVi8GAbku
transaction
6877fa630e6da41ab598025f5b0dba4380e40b6845626eb10a2e085d8c5a8488
spent
true